War between Dwarfs and Chaos Dwarfs is a civil war or a religious one?
Religious. Essentially a long long time ago the chaos dwards broke away from the dwarfs and began following Hashut. A minor chaos god of fire, darkness, etc.
A mix of both, but at this point the chaos dwarfs are practically a different race their physiology is so different
need to mention also that the original dwarfs that turned into chorfs were abandoned by their fellow dwarfs and out of desperation and bitterness they turned to hashut to save them
They didn’t abandon them, that’s Chorf revisionism. The clans that went to the skull lands moved so far off that when the Great Catastrophe struck, the western dwarfs were cut off from the dwarfs in the Dark Lands by the erupting forces of Chaos and believed them all dead. They simply didn’t know better.
